Bakuchiol

Bakuchiol, pronounced "buh-koo-chee-all," is a natural compound derived from the seeds and leaves of the Psoralea corylifolia plant, commonly known as babchi. This plant has been used for centuries in traditional Ayurvedic and Chinese medicine for its various therapeutic properties. Native to regions of India, China, and other parts of Southeast Asia, bakuchiol extract is obtained through careful extraction methods that preserve its beneficial properties.

Although bakuchiol has been used in traditional medicine for centuries, its popularity in skincare gained momentum in the late 20th and early 21st centuries. Researchers and skincare experts began to explore its potential as a natural alternative to retinol, driven by consumer demand for effective yet gentle skincare solutions.

The compound's rise to fame was marked by several studies demonstrating its efficacy in improving skin elasticity, reducing hyperpigmentation, and enhancing overall skin health. Today, bakuchiol can be found in various skincare products such as serums, creams, and oils, catering to individuals seeking natural, plant-based alternatives in their beauty routines.

Bakuchiol has gained attention in recent years due to its skincare benefits, often being referred to as a natural alternative to retinol.

 

Here are some key benefits:

1. Anti-aging Properties: Similar to retinol, bakuchiol is known for its ability to stimulate collagen production, which helps in re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. It also promotes cell turnover, resulting in smoother and more youthful-looking skin.

2. Anti-inflammatory and Antioxidant: Bakuchiol exhibits strong anti-inflammatory properties, making it suitable for sensitive skin types that may not tolerate retinoids well. It also acts as an antioxidant, protecting the skin from free radical damage caused by environmental stressors.

 

3. Improves Skin Texture: Regular use of bakuchiol can improve skin texture and even out skin tone, giving a more radiant complexion.

 

4. Gentle and Well-Tolerated: Unlike retinol, which can cause irritation, dryness, and sun sensitivity in some individuals, bakuchiol is generally well-tolerated and does not cause the same level of side effects.
